Argentina enters the match averaging 58.67% ball possession. They have been ruthless in the final third, netting 17 goals across six matches on 95 total shots. Lionel Messi serves as their undisputed offensive engine, leading the tournament with an astonishing eight goals and two assists.England counters with a 57.83% average possession and their own lethal finishing. Harry Kane (six goals, one assist) and Jude Bellingham (six goals) anchor an English side that has scored 13 times from 92 total shots, including an impressive 45 shots on target. With both nations having conceded exactly six goals so far, traders evaluating the market must weigh two elite attacks against identical defensive records.When analyzing squad availability, key absences could shift the implied probability as kickoff approaches. England will be without midfielder Jordan Henderson due to injury and defender Jarell Quansah, who is serving a suspension. These missing pieces may force tactical adjustments in how England sets up against a relentless opponent.
